Requirements for Registered Representatives in the State of Washington
In the State of Washington, a registered agent must be a inhabitant of the region or a corporation permitted to operate in Washington. This requirement ensures that there is a dependable point of communication inside the region for legal proceedings, official paperwork, and important communications. If you select a business entity as your registered agent, it should be licensed to do business in Washington and have a physical office address inside the state.
The agent must also have a real address; P.O. boxes are not acceptable. registered agent setup process will be publicly listed as the official office of your company, so it is crucial to choose an address that adheres with state laws and meets the expectations of privacy and professional standards. The registered agent must be available during regular business hours to accept paperwork on behalf of the company.
Moreover, it is important for the registered agent to maintain proper records and issue prompt alerts to the company regarding any official papers collected. This role is vital in maintaining compliance with the State of Washington’s business regulations and making sure that the company remains updated of any legal obligations or modifications that may affect its operations.
Alterting Your Registered Agent in Washington
Alterting your registered agent in the State of Washington is a simple process that requires providing the correct forms to the Secretary of State. To begin the change, you will need to complete a Statement of Change of Registered Agent document, which can generally be done through an online portal or by mail. Make registered agent document scanning to have the incoming registered agent's details ready, including their full name and address, as this will be necessary on the form.
Once you send the form, it's crucial to let know your new registered agent that they have been appointed for this role. This makes sure they are ready to handle legal documents and official correspondence on your behalf. Additionally, ensure that the new agent meets Washington's requirements for registered agents, such as being a resident of the State of Washington or a business entity licensed to do business in the state.
After the change has been finalized, you will receive notification from the Secretary of State. It is recommended to keep a copy of the acknowledgment for your records.
